Accomplished writer, podcaster (Why Are People Into That?!?), educator, and kink connoisseur, Tina Horn joins Sarah and Robin to unpack consensual non-consent. Tina brings her signature wit and intellect to this nuanced discussion about total power exchange. The conversation covers why non-consensual dynamics can be enticing to explore in play and the metaphorical nature of fantasy play. We dive into how complicated it is to clearly define consent and dismantle rape culture, the appeal of monster sex, BDSM as storytelling, and we learn about the 90s heartthrobs that left an impression on Tina. The conversation wraps up with a glimpse into Tina's process of developing her riveting, sex-positive, sci fi dystopian comic book series SfSx.
CW: this episode touches on forced sex, and rape fantasies. Please take care while listening.
Tina Horn is the creator and writer of the sci-fi sex-rebel comic book series SfSx (Safe Sex). She is currently working on a book version of her long-running kink podcast Why Are People Into That?! and was the host and co-writer of the Wondery podcast series Operator. Her reporting on sexual subcultures and politics has appeared in Rolling Stone, Playboy, Hazlitt, Glamour, Jezebel and elsewhere; she is the author of two nonfiction books and has contributed to numerous anthologies including We Too: Essays on Sex Work and Survival, which she also co-edited. Tina has lectured on sex worker politics and queer BDSM identities at universities and community centers all over North America, and works as an on-set consultant for theater, film, and television including the dominatrix scenes of Pose. She is a LAMBDA Literary Fellow, an AVN nominee, the recipient of two Feminist Porn Awards, and holds an MFA in Creative Nonfiction Writing from Sarah Lawrence.
